Getting Worse: Eggs Unlimited weighs in on how Trump administration might tackle the ripple effects of HPAI

“It has just not gone away and in some cases, it has gotten worse.”

The Trump administration is taking a close look at mass culling in the poultry sector. It comes amid soaring egg prices and looming availability concerns stemming from high path avian influenza.

Brian Moscogiuri with Eggs Unlimited spoke with RFD-TV’s own Suzanne Alexander on HPAI ripple effects, biosecurity measures, and how the new administration aims to tackle the situation.
